> the following defaults are set in hdfs-defaults.xml
> <property>
> <name>dfs.web.authentication.kerberos.principal</name>
> <value>HTTP/${dfs.web.hostname}@${kerberos.realm}</value>
> <description>
> The HTTP Kerberos principal used by Hadoop-Auth in the HTTP endpoint.
> The HTTP Kerberos principal MUST start with 'HTTP/' per Kerberos
> HTTP SPENGO specification.
> </description>
> </property>
> <property>
> <name>dfs.web.authentication.kerberos.keytab</name>
> <value>${user.home}/dfs.web.keytab</value>
> <description>
> The Kerberos keytab file with the credentials for the
> HTTP Kerberos principal used by Hadoop-Auth in the HTTP endpoint.
> </description>
> </property>
> These properties should not have defaults
